Critical prolines required for effect of hBest1 on CaV1.3. A, Alignment (ClustalW) of the C-terminal region of hBest1, mBest1, mBest2, and mBest3. Boxed amino acids represent the critical CT region involved in the regulation of Ca2+ channels. Prolines located at 330 and 334 (indicated by arrows) were mutated. B, I–V relationships for recombinant L-type CaV1.3 channel (α11.3/β1b2δ) alone (open circles), with wt-hBest1 (filled circles), or P330W/P334W-hBest1 (triangles). C, Averaged Ba2+ peak current densities at −10 mV for CaV1.3. *p < 0.01 for Ca channel plus hBest1 compared with Ca channel alone by two-way ANOVA. D, I–V relationship for Ca2+-activated Cl currents recorded with the protocol described in Figure 1Aa from cells transfected with wt-hBest1 (open circles) or P330W/P334W-hBest1 (filled circles). E, Lysates from intact, wt-hBest1, or P330W/P334W mutant transfected HEK293 cells were detected with anti-myc antibodies.
